Greetings to all from SoCal!
I've been awaiting the new BRZ and have been anxious to get one. Production and distrobution has has seemed somewhat slower than I anticipated. Most Dealers are taking full advantage of this fact to the point of what I consider covert price gouging. Glendale, CA Subaru quoted me $7500 over a BRZ Premium they had in stock after I wrangled it out of them on the phone. They of course wanted me to come in and surprise me right there. Needless to say they know what I think of a 36% mark up. I've encountered this from all of the local dealers, not to the unscroupulous extent of Glendale though. I'll wait and/or find a reputable dealer to order though if possible. I regularly check kbb.com for BRZ inventory and have discovered something peculiar and somewhat unsettling. The are used BRZ's for sale listed there for months now, i.e. not one or two but say ten. Check for yourself. So let's say for example that 20% of those that I see used for sale are due to people not really being able to afford them after all. Well then there's the rest of them that I really want to know why they are already up for resale. Profiteers perhaps? I'd really like to know the answer before I go and purchase one. New member here from the Tampa Bay area!
I originally ordered a WRB Premium 6MT from a local dealer back in early June. After several months of waiting and no ETA or and updates, I started looking around for cars on Autotrader and cars.com. Almost every dealer I spoke to, wanted a $2,000-$3,000 markup on the BRZ. I finally found 6 BRZs at Subaru of Jacksonville, and found out they were selling all of them for MSRP! I called them to reserve the WRB limited they had, but someone beat me to it by literally 10 minutes. Ended up reserving a SSM Limited 6MT and drove 244 miles to purchase it the next day. On November 25th, I became a proud owner of a Subaru BRZ. ![]() Even though silver was one of the last colors I wanted, I fell in love once I saw it in person. It really has a clean and classic look to it. My previous car was a 1999 Toyota Avalon XLS, so the handling of this car is night and day.
